Hobs with induction

Induction hobs have smooth, flat surfaces that are easier than gas hobs in terms of cleaning. They consume less energy and provide precise temperature control, which makes them perfect for delicate sauces and searing meats. They cool quickly so you won't get burned should you touch them. You will need to use a compatible set of cookware to use these. They are also not suitable for people who have pacemakers as the electromagnetic field generated by induction may interfere.

A majority of induction hobs come with indicators that show power levels and settings, giving an air of futuristic design to your kitchen. Some have bridge zones that let you combine cooking areas to accommodate larger pans which makes them an ideal option for grilling pans. Some models have an enhancement feature that temporarily increases power output in a zone. This allows you to quickly bring water to a boil, or sear your meat.

Another feature that is useful is an indicator of residual heat that indicates whether the hob remains hot after it's been shut off. This feature can help prevent accidental burns in households with children under the age of. Some stoves have child locks to keep your little ones safe while cooking.

Gas hobs

Gas ovens hobs are a staple of UK kitchens, thanks to their combination of instant warmth and precise temperature control. They also sport sleek and professional looks that can be integrated into a variety of kitchen designs. In addition, most modern gas hobs feature automatic ignition. This means that turning on the stove triggers an electric spark to ignite the gas within the burner. This is safer than older gas hobs that required matchboxes and lighters. The visual flame indicator of gas hobs helps to determine if the flame is on or off, which can help prevent accidental burns and gas leaks.

There are a variety of different choices available for gas hobs, from simple single-burner designs, to wide, power-filled wok burners. Some models come with dual-flame burners, which allow you to control the heat and adjust the size of the flame. Other features include an evaporation flame that blocks the loss of heat from the sides of the burner and a sleek toughened glass surface that is easy to clean.

Hobs with solid-plate construction

Providing a simple yet reliable cooking solution, solid plate hobs and ovens have been the most popular choice for many homes over the decades. They operate by heating flat metal plates using electricity, making them a budget-friendly option that is easy to use and clean. Their simple design could make them less energy-efficient than other hobs, which can lead to higher electric bills. In addition they take longer to warm up and cool down than other hobs, which could be frustrating if you're used to faster cook times.

A great option for those on a budget Solid plate hobs offer uniform heating distribution and are compatible with all types of pots and pans. They also offer simple dial controls for convenient temperature adjustments. They also have an indicator light that indicates when the plate is hot or turned on to ensure safety.

The solid plate design is prone to electrical short-circuits and may need more maintenance than other hobs. They are also less flexible than other kinds of hobs Uk like ceramic and induction.

Although they are an affordable option however, solid plate hobs are gradually being replaced by more modern options like ceramic and induction. They are more efficient in energy consumption and provide modern design options that match your kitchen's aesthetic. They can also come with a variety of finishes, such as stainless steel and black glass to fit your taste.

Ceramic hobs

Ceramic hobs are elegant and fashionable. They are a popular option for modern kitchens. They are also cheaper than other models due to their flat surface. They're also very energy efficient, as the heating elements only heat the hob surface and not the pans sitting on the top.

Similar to induction hobs, ceramic ones come with many features to help you cook more efficiently and more efficient. Certain models, for instance they come with a FlexiDuo function that permits you to combine two cooking zones into one space to accommodate larger pots. These models also come with residual temperature indicators as well as child locks in order to ensure your children's safety.

The primary difference between an induction and a ceramic hob is that a ceramic hob does not make use of magnetic fields to warm the pans. Instead, they utilize electrical heating elements beneath each cooking zone. This means that they take a little longer to warm up and cool down than induction hobs. However, they do have a good track record in terms of energy efficiency.

They're more expensive than gas hobs and solid-plate hobs however they provide many advantages which make them worth it. They are easy to clean and since they don't have open flames, they are less likely to burn your hands. They're also more energy efficient than gas hobs, and more environmentally friendly because they consume less energy over time.
